ZORYANA SKALECKA

Zoryana Skaletska is a leading figure in the area of medical law, recognized as one of the few experts in Ukraine. She held the position of Minister of Health of Ukraine from 2019 to 2020. As an analyst in medical and pharmaceutical law, Zoryana provides consultancy services to international organizations and contributes to legislative initiatives and expert opinions on healthcare regulation. She has been actively involved in medical reform as an expert in the Reanimation Package of Reforms, leading the medical group from 2014 to 2017. Additionally, she has served as a member of the Advisory Council on Healthcare of the Committee of the Verkhovna Rada of Ukraine on Healthcare (2007–2009) and as Chair of the Commission on Healthcare Reform of the Public Council at the Ministry of Health of Ukraine (2011–2014). Zoryana is currently Chair of the Board of the NGO “Ukrainian Medical-Legal Association,” a member of the Board of the NGO “Ukrainian League for Palliative and Hospice Care Development,” and Director of the NGO “Health Forum.” She is also a member of the World Medical Law Association. Since 2006, Zoryana has been associated with the National University of “Kyiv-Mohyla Academy,” where she serves as an associate professor and Deputy Dean of the Faculty of Law. She teaches courses on “Human Rights and Biomedicine” and “Medical Law” and directs the program “Ethical and Legal Issues of Bioethics, Pharmaceutical, and Medical Law” at the Center for International Human Rights Protection at NaUKMA. Zoryana’s expertise in medical law has earned her recognition from prestigious national rankings as one of the top experts in Ukraine in her area.

Zlata Simonenko

Zlata Symonenko specialises in the areas of criminal investigations and litigation. She is experienced in handling financial and corruption crime cases. Zlata represents clients through all aspects of criminal litigation and regulatory enforcement actions, from the initiation of a criminal case to court hearings, including investigative actions. She also has considerable experience of appeals to the European Court of Human Rights. In addition to her legal practice, Zlata is actively involved in legislation drafting. In particular, she took part in drafting the laws on National Police, National Anticorruption Bureau, Financing of political parties and fighting against political corruption. Prior to joining Sayenko Kharenko, Zlata worked for Solodko & Partners, one of the leading WCC boutique law firms in Ukraine.
